Block Wall Replacement Questions
What are common reasons to replace a block wall? Block walls may need replacement due to cracking, leaning, or damage from weather and age.
How can I tell if my block wall needs replacement? Signs include significant cracks, loose or missing blocks, or visible shifting and bowing.
What types of projects typically require block wall replacement? Projects often involve rebuilding retaining walls, garden boundaries, or security enclosures that have deteriorated.
What should property owners consider before replacing a block wall? It's important to assess the condition of the existing wall and determine if repair or full replacement is most suitable.
